May Be Returned.
Pottage starups that are damaged by
sticking together In warm or dump
weather may b returned to tlie de
partment aud their value repaid to the
purchaser or exchanged for new
slumps. If you spoil n stamped en
velope In attempting; to write the ad
dressbu It, do not tnro-v it away, for
yon can also return it to the post
office and recei.-e the stamp value. All
the redeemed envelopes 'and stumps are
Bent to the postoflloe department by
the postmaster redeeming them. These
reulatiouB are not generally known
and they may he of sumo benefit to a
large number ot people.

Collection for Portland Boys' and
Girls' Aid Society.
Robert J Wilson, agent of the Port
laud Boys' and Girls' Aid Society, is in
Eugene making arrangements for a
publlo school donation of necessaries
required , for that deserving public
charity.
Dr Strong will collect money that
may be donated at the University. The
forwarding of donations will be placed
:; In the bands of J M Williams. Publlo
acknowledgement will be made by the
S society of the receipt of all coutribu
' : lions.

The Dalles Chronicle says Indian
George, a full-blood Hiwash, who yean
igo followed sheep herding InWssio
county and now owns a stock ranch
on the j on n uny, applied for a license
to marry a while woman. The license
was leiused hllli,

WM. J, BKYA.N
Offered Several Editorial Positions
at Large Salaries.
DENVER, Colo, Nov in Colonel W
J Hryau has declined an otter of au
editorial position on a Denver after
noou newspaper at a salary of $10,000 a
year, iu his reply, which was tele
graphed from Ltuooln, Neb, today,
be says:
"1 sball remain here, and In the fu
ture, as In the past,defeud with tougue
and pen the priuoiple which I believe
to be right aud the policies 1 believe to
ne wise."
Ou the top of the foregoing comes
the statement from Washington, D I-',
mat W R Hearst, proprietor of the
Sao Frauolsoo Examiner, New York
Journal aud Chicago Ameiican, is to
begin l lie publication of a daily paper
at the national capital wllnlu the next
momh, bis edttur-iU'Obief to be Wil
liam Jeuutngs Bryan. Bryau'ssaiary,
it Is said, will be $5,000 a year.
